随着信息化时代的高速发展,计算机系统的应用越来越广泛,如何对计算机系统进行安全可靠的管理成为了一个重要的问题。在进行计算机系统管理的过程中,账户管理尤为重要。在Linux系统中,通过SQL语言可以创建账户,本文将详细介绍在Linux系统下使用SQL创建账户的过程。
让客户满意是我们工作的目标,不断超越客户的期望值来自于我们对这个行业的热爱。我们立志把好的技术通过有效、简单的方式提供给客户,将通过不懈努力成为客户在信息化领域值得信任、有价值的长期合作伙伴,公司提供的服务项目有:域名注册、虚拟主机、营销软件、网站建设、南昌县网站维护、网站推广。
1.安装MySQL数据库
MySQL是一种开源的关系型数据库管理系统,是Linux系统下非常流行的数据库之一。因此,首先需要在Linux系统上安装MySQL数据库。
在Linux系统中安装MySQL数据库可以通过命令行进行安装:
sudo apt-get update
sudo apt-get install mysql-server
安装完成后,可以通过以下命令检查MySQL的版本号:
mysql -V
2.通过SQL创建MySQL账户
在Database层面,用户账户实际上是Database中的一个Object。在MySQL数据库中创建一个账户的命令是:
CREATE USER ‘username’@’host’ IDENTIFIED BY ‘password’;
其中,username是账户的名称,host指的是连接此账户的客户端主机,password表示该账户的密码。如果要让该用户拥有所有的权限,可以使用以下命令:
GRANT ALL PRIVILEGES ON *.* TO ‘username’@’host’;
如果只想让该用户拥有某个特定Database的权限,可以使用以下命令:
GRANT ALL PRIVILEGES ON dbname.* TO ‘username’@’host’;
3.绑定Linux用户
完成以上步骤后,我们在MySQL中已经创建了一个账户。但是,该用户不能直接登录Linux系统,我们需要将该用户与Linux用户进行绑定。具体步骤如下:
我们需要在Linux系统中创建一个新的用户。在命令窗口中输入以下命令:
sudo adduser new_user
如上所述,new_user表示需要创建的新用户的名称。该命令将提示您输入新用户的密码,及一些其他的信息。
接下来,通过以下命令将new_user用户和新创建的MySQL用户account进行绑定:
sudo usermod -aG mysql new_user
这个命令会将new_user添加到mysql用户组中,从而允许new_user连接MySQL数据库。现在,当new_user登录到Linux系统时,他可以通过MySQL账户account登录到MySQL数据库。
4.测试MySQL账户
我们可以通过MySQL客户端工具来测试MySQL账户是否创建成功。在命令行窗口中输入以下命令:
mysql -u account -p
然后输入账户的密码,进入到MySQL客户端中。如果成功登录,说明我们已经完成了在Linux系统下使用SQL创建账户的过程。
综上所述,在Linux系统中使用SQL创建账户是一种常见的账户管理方法,并且相对容易操作。通过上述的步骤,我们可以很快地创建一个新账户,并进行绑定。当然,在创建账户的过程中需要特别注意安全性问题。我们应该谨慎地授予权限,避免账户管理员对系统做出不当的操作。同时,我们也应该密切关注和及时更新系统的安全补丁,以确保系统的稳定和安全。
相关问题拓展阅读:
已Oracle为例:咐亮
1、当前用户首先切换到Oracle用户下,su oralce
2、登模宴录数据库,sqlplus user/password
3、输入sql脚步,注意脚衡码宽步结束必须“;”,回车运行。
linux在sql开账号的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于linux在sql开账号,Linux下使用SQL创建账户,sql脚本怎么在linux执行的信息别忘了在本站进行查找喔。
成都网站推广找创新互联,老牌网站营销公司
成都网站建设公司创新互联(www.cdcxhl.com)专注高端网站建设,网页设计制作,网站维护,网络营销,SEO优化推广,快速提升企业网站排名等一站式服务。IDC基础服务:云服务器、虚拟主机、网站系统开发经验、服务器租用、服务器托管提供四川、成都、绵阳、雅安、重庆、贵州、昆明、郑州、湖北十堰机房互联网数据中心业务。
网页题目:Linux下使用SQL创建账户 (linux在sql开账号)
本文URL:http://www.shufengxianlan.com/qtweb/news40/65090.html
网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联